Functional and structural differences in brain networks involved in language processing and control in highly proficient early and late bilinguals
Journal of Neurolinguistics ( IF 1.2 ) Pub Date : 2021-01-28 , DOI: 10.1016/j.jneuroling.2021.100988
Barbara Köpke , Ruairidh K.R. Howells , Francesca Cortelazzo , Patrice Péran , Xavier de Boissezon , Vincent Lubrano

Age of acquisition and proficiency have been identified as possible determinants in the neural localization of second language representation and in the nature of control mechanisms. However, the relationship is not yet clear between age of acquisition and proficiency on the one hand, and language switching and executive functions on the other. In the present study, we used anatomical and functional Magnetic Resonance (MR) Imaging to investigate the impact of age of acquisition. Two groups of highly proficient early and late bilinguals, carefully matched in other measures of proficiency, performed an overt picture-naming task in blocked and switched conditions.

We found that switching between languages in highly proficient bilinguals involves an increase of activity in areas reported as components associated with domain-general inhibitory processes. There was no effect of task language, only of whether the task involved language switching. Comparing the two groups indicated that highly proficient bilinguals use the same neural network for language production and control regardless of age of acquisition. Structural differences were apparent between the two groups in regions associated with language control.

We propose that language switching recruits a neural network that is engaged for domain-general executive control functions and that proficiency rather than age of acquisition exerts influence on language representations.
